Course Content

• Introduction to Cosmology and the Big Bang Theory
• The Physics of the Cosmic Microwave Background Radiation (CMB)
• CMB Anisotropies and Power Spectrum Analysis
• CMB Polarization and Primordial Gravitational Waves
• Data Analysis Techniques for CMB Experiments
• Cosmological Parameter Estimation from CMB Data
• Advanced Topics in CMB Physics: Inflation and Dark Energy
• The Future of CMB Research and Upcoming Experiments

Career path

Career Role (Cosmic Microwave Background Radiation) Description
Astrophysicist (CMB Research) Analyze CMB data, develop theoretical models, publish findings in peer-reviewed journals. High demand for expertise in cosmological data analysis.
Data Scientist (Cosmology) Utilize machine learning techniques to process massive CMB datasets, identify anomalies, and contribute to advancements in cosmological understanding. Strong programming and statistical skills are crucial.
Software Engineer (CMB Experiment) Develop and maintain software for CMB experiments, processing pipelines, and data visualization tools. Essential role in ensuring accurate data acquisition and analysis.
Research Scientist (Radio Astronomy) Conduct research related to CMB using radio telescopes, analyze signal processing, and contribute to experimental design. Requires expertise in radio astronomy techniques and CMB physics.
